Cracked Heel Treatments
The following home remedies for cracked heels are easy to find and use, and inexpensive. Both men and women can use them to get rid of their condition.
- Before using any remedy, first wash your feet thoroughly with soap and water. You can rub sesame oil on the affected areas and leave it overnight. After applying the oil, wear socks for the effects to endure.
- Lemon water is another great cracked heel treatment. Squeeze a lemon into a glass of warm water. Apply on the affected heels and after some time use a pumice stone to rub dead skin from the cracked heels.
- Coconut oil can do wonders too. Massage the cracked heels using coconut oil. Keep the oil on overnight and wear socks. Next morning, use a pumice stone and rub the heels and then wash your feet with warm water.
- To moisturize your feet, use coconut, avocado and banana pulp to make a paste. Apply the paste evenly on the affected parts. Leave it on for about 15 minutes and then wash off using warm water.
- Soak your cracked feet for a few minutes in warm, soapy water to make the skin soft. Then, use pumice stone to rub the dead skin off the heels.
- Make a mixture of lemon and papaya juice to treat cracked heels. Apply this mixture on the heels and rinse after 20 minutes.

Cracked Heel Treatment: Home Remedies
- Wash your feet regularly and keep them clean, especially after you return home from work or play. At night, go to bed with clean feet. You can also apply a foot cream or lotion on the feet after washing them.
- Winter season causes a rise in the incidence of cracked heels all over the world. To prevent this, sleep wearing warm socks. Do not walk on the cold ground but wear slippers for protection.
- If your cracked heels have wide gaps, you can cure them by applying a mixture of coconut oil with melted paraffin wax. Apply this mixture in the gaps. Within a couple of weeks, the gaps will disappear and the feet will become soft and smooth.
- Ensure you wear footwear that are of the right size and comfortable for you.
- Another effective cracked heel treatment is to soak your feet in warm salt water for a few minutes.
- You can also walk on the soft grass in the lawn or garden to cure cracked heels.
